The short version

Boulder has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$12,500. The city has more than doubled in size since 2009, adding 21 residents. 0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 24%. With a median age of 46.0, the population is older than the US median of 35.2. The poverty rate of 33.3% is well above the national figure. Households here earn about 67% less than the Wyoming median.
